François Berteloot - Professor of Mathematics, Institut de Mathématiques de Toulouse
My research is primarily situated at the intersection of complex analysis and dynamical systems. I am particularly interested in the study of holomorphic families of rational maps, bifurcation currents, and Lyapunov exponents, utilizing tools from pluripotential theory and non-standard analysis to understand dynamical stability.
I am currently a Professor of Mathematics at the Toulouse Institute of Mathematics and member of the international faculty for the International Mathematics Master in Algeria.

The Mandelbrot set is the shadow of a Julia set
Joint work with Tien-Cuong Dinh. Working within the polynomial quadratic family, we introduce a new point of view on bifurcations which naturally allows to see the seat of bifurcations as the projection of a Julia set of a complex dynamical system in dimension three.
